Health and Wellbeing Program (HWP): The Most Common Usage
Among the various definitions, HWP as Health and Wellbeing Programme is widely recognized, especially in:

- Corporate employee assistance programs (EAPs)
- Hospital outreach initiatives
- Academic campus health services
- Government public health campaigns
These programs typically offer resources such as:
- Mental health counseling
- Fitness coaching
- Nutrition workshops
- Stress management training
HWPs are designed to improve quality of life, reduce burnout, and enhance productivity—critical components in modern wellness strategies.
